摘要
This letter considers joint channel estimation and data sequence detection for multipath radio channels with multiple antennas at the transmitter and/or receiver. An iterative space-time receiver based on the expectation-maximization algorithm is proposed. We examine the performance of this receiver on Rayleigh fading channels for transmit diversity and space-time coding methods. Simulation results show that the receiver can often achieve near-coherent performance with modest complexity and using very few pilot symbols.
